Shorty Meeks (Marlon Wayans) He is based upon Randy from "Scream" and Max from "I Know". He is Brenda's brother and is shot in the chest by Bobby. However, he comes back in Scary Movie 2.

Ray Wilkins (Shawn Wayans) He is based upon Phil from "Scream 2" and Stu from the first "Scream." His name is taken from the character Ray in the "I Know" series. He is Brenda's boyfriend but is openly gay and is stabbed in the head by a penis (parody of Phil's death). He is later alive in the film and is Bobby's accomplice (parody of Stu). He is then stabbed in the back by the real killer, but comes back in the sequel.

Buffy Gilmore (Shannon Elizabeth) She is based upon Tatum from "Scream" and Helen from "I Know". She is decapitated but her head remains alive. Her name comes from the character Buffy from the TV show "Buffy the Vampire Slayer", who was played by Sarah Michelle Gellar and who also played Helen in "I Know What You Did Last Summer."

Greg Phillipe (Lochlyn Munro) He is based upon Barry from "I Know". His first name Greg is related to Cindy and Bobby, all characters on "The Brady Bunch." His last name is from actor Ryan Phillipe, who played Barry. He is killed by Doofy at the pageant (parody of Barry's death).

Drew Decker (Carmen Electra) She is based upon Casey from "Scream" and is the first killed in the movie. Her name is from actress Drew Barrymore, who played Casey.

Doofy Gilmore (Dave Sheridan) He is based upon Deputy Dewey from the "Scream" movies, Doofy being a spoof of Dewey. He is Buffy's brother and is believed to be mentally retarded. He is also the "real" killer in the movie. At the end of the movie, it is revealed that he faked being retarded.

Gail Hailstorm (Cheri Oteri) She is based upon Gail Weathers from the "Scream" movies, her last name Hailstorm being a joke on Weathers. She commits a murder in the movie by running over a boy. She and her cameraman are killed, but she shows up at the end and picks up Doofy for a date.

The original Scary Movie film was highly successful, grossing over $42 million in its first weekend and going on to gross over $278 million worldwide. Its sequels were also successful, and continued to be parodies of horror films and other films and television shows, all while spoofing horror sequels. It is also considered to be one of the first in a long line of recent spoof films, including "Not Another Teen Movie", "Date Movie", "Epic Movie", and "Meet the Spartans."
